memory
Неожиданно превысив лимит памяти PHP с помощью одного запроса PDO?
У меня есть действительно простой запрос, который выглядит примерно так:
$result = $pdo->query('SELECT * FROM my_t ... у же ошибку.
Я думал, что это должно было приносить только одну строку за раз; почему он использует так много память?
Проблемы с PHP при попытке создать большой массив
Вот мой код, который создает 2d массив, заполненный нулями, размеры массива (795,6942):
function zeros($rowCount, $col ... я получаю:
Allowed memory size of 134217728 bytes exhausted (tried to allocate 35 bytes)
Есть идеи, как это решить?
Соображения о памяти для длительных php-скриптов
Я хочу написать рабочий файл для beanstalkd на php, используя контроллер Zend Framework 2. Он запускается через интерфе ... }
}
Как все замечают, потребление памяти в php не используется и сведено к минимуму, но со временем увеличивается.
Есть ли способ получить размер переменной PHP в байтах?
В настоящее время у меня есть скрипт PHP CLI, широко использующий Zend Framework, который, похоже, использует все больш ... ия.
Мой вопрос в том, есть ли в PHP способ определить размер переменной в памяти, чтобы я мог отслеживать, что растет?
Может ли определение большого количества констант вызвать проблемы с производительностью или памятью?
У меня есть веб-сайт, который использует множество констант, которые определяются следующим образом, например:
define ... к запускается каждый раз при загрузке страницы. Это сильно повлияет на мою производительность или использование памяти?
В PHP, что происходит в памяти, когда мы используем запрос mysql
Я использовал для извлечения большого объема данных с помощью mysql_query, а затем повторял результат один за другим дл ... ся в производительности. Пожалуйста, не комментируйте код, я просто придумал его в качестве примера для поста.
Спасибо
Разрешенный объем памяти 134217728 байт исчерпан
Как решить эту проблему и почему это происходит?
Журнал сервера Zend:
Неустранимая ошибка PHP: Разрешенный объем ... из браузера. Однако, если я использую его функции из другого файла PHO, то журнал Zend печатает вышеупомянутое ошибка.
Самый быстрый кэш памяти PHP/хэш-таблица [закрыта]
Я ищу самый быстрый кэш/хэш-таблицу в памяти, доступный для PHP.
Я буду хранить в нем некоторые значения конфигурации ... ак можно меньше накладных расходов.
Данные будут небольшими и детализированными.
Что бы вы порекомендовали и почему?
Как PHP назначает и освобождает память для переменных?
Мне было интересно, когда PHP освобождает память, которая используется для переменных
Например
function foo(){
$fo ... is the memory space for `$foo` emptied at this point?
}
Это медленнее, чем:
function foo(){
return 'data';
}
?
Использование памяти php-процессом
РЕЗЮМЕ
Краткие рекомендации (из более подробной информации, содержащейся в данных, см. Ответы)
Чтобы избежать утеч ... ndard
sysvmsg
sysvsem
sysvshm
tokenizer
wddx
xml
xmlreader
xmlwriter
Zend OPcache
zip
zlib
[Zend Modules]
Zend OPcache
Предупреждение PHP: Содержимое ПУБЛИКАЦИИ - Длина 113 байт превышает ограничение -1988100096 байт в неизвестном
У меня было много проблем с пользователями, загружающими изображения на мой сайт.
Они могут загружать до 6 изображений ... ST Content-Length of 11933650 bytes exceeds the limit of 8388608 bytes in Unknown on line 0
Есть идеи, где я ошибаюсь?
Очистить память, используемую PHP
Я столкнулся с интересной проблемой. Я использую PHPUnit, и мои тесты занимают больше памяти каждый раз, когда я их за ... ть, почему тест PHPUnit, выполняемый из командной строки, будет использовать память, которая "зависает" между запусками.
phpexcel Разрешенный объем памяти 134217728 байт исчерпан [дубликат]
На этот вопрос уже есть ответ здесь:
В PHPExcel не хватает 256, 512, а также 1024 МБ операт ... ries/PHPExcel/Worksheet.php
на линии 961
Это проблема phpexcel или я делаю что-то не так?
Как я могу это исправить?
Опыт работы с PHP QuickHash для больших массивов
Есть ли у кого-нибудь опыт работы с PHP QuickHash (http://php.net/manual/en/book .quickhash.php)?
Некоторые ранние те ... в производственной среде, поэтому мне любопытно узнать, есть ли какие-либо причины не использовать его в производство.
Минимизация использования памяти PHP при запуске скрипта
У меня есть скрипт, который отправляет данные (размером около 16 МБ), которые я читаю с помощью php://input.
$in = fil ... дь еще, чтобы PHP потреблял меньше памяти при запуске?
Это дало бы мне больше памяти для работы с полученными данными.
Потребление памяти в сценарии итерации
У меня есть скрипт, написанный на PHP, и такой же скрипт, написанный на Javascript.
Он повторяется миллион раз и каждый ... бы придумать, была ли природа V8 использовать скрытые классы, повышающие скорость, но увеличивающие потребление памяти.
Сбой Apache с фрагментом munmap(): неверный указатель после обновления до php7 на Джесси
Я недавно обновил php до версии 7.0.4 на своем сервере под управлением Debian 8.
Вот что дает мне dpkg -l | grep php: ... как бы случайно. Иногда тот же запрос завершается успешно, что и минуту назад, с этой ошибкой. Я бы оценил вашу помощь.
Codeigniter Допустил исчерпание объема памяти при обработке больших файлов
Я публикую это на случай, если кто-то еще ищет такое же решение, учитывая, что я только что потратил два дня на эту еру ... ленных новыми строками.
Проблема: он обработает только около 20 000 строк, прежде чем у всего этого закончится память.
Огромный массив занимает больше места в памяти, чем следовало бы
В настоящее время мое приложение использует около 7 МБ памяти.
Массив, по-видимому, использует 700 КБ, если я проверю ... ли этот массив занимает 700 КБ сериализованного, зачем PHP нужно 7 МБ для этой переменной? Или я делаю тест неправильно?
PHP: как результаты запроса хранятся в результате mysqli
Когда я сделал запрос к базе данных и получил результаты в mysqli_result, использование памяти крайне мало. Однако, ког ... запрашивались в базу данных каждый раз, когда fetch_assoc называемый. Итак, где же тогда хранятся результаты в памяти?